Blame the DOM (Document Object Model)

Most free online teleprompters are made by amateurs. They try to move text by changing "page position" (CSS Top/Margin).

This forces browser to Repaint the entire screen every millimeter of movement. In long scripts, this eats 100% of your CPU, causing heat and freezes.

The PromptNinja Solution: GPU Acceleration

We were software engineers before building this app. PromptNinja uses a technique called requestAnimationFrame combined with Hardware Acceleration.

2. Close Heavy Tabs

Sites like Facebook, LinkedIn, and Analytics Dashboards consume huge RAM. Close them while recording.
3

3. 'Game Mode' on Windows

If on Windows, enable 'Game Mode'. This prioritizes active window (teleprompter) and silences background processes.
4

4. Disable Extensions

Badly coded AdBlockers sometimes try to scan teleprompter text, causing lag. Use Incognito tab to test.

Why text blurs when scrolling?

This is called 'Ghosting' and depends on your monitor response time (ms). Gaming monitors (144hz) eliminate this. On common screens, try increasing font size and lowering speed to reduce visual effect.
